**Q: How do candidates get into the Willowmere Room for interviews?**

Good question! The Willowmere Room on level 2 is badge-locked, so candidates can't wander in on their own. Walk them up yourself and make sure the hiring manager is already inside before you leave. If the manager's running late, park the candidate at the reception sofas. To open the door yourself, use the pass code below.

door code, kawip-bagap: bdg-HQEWH-4

**Ticket: Config drift on ScaleChef staging**

Staging for ScaleChef, our recipe-scaling calculator, no longer matches what's in the repo. Someone hand-edited the rounding mode and unit-conversion precision on the box directly, so fraction outputs differ between staging and production — QA caught it when a doubled recipe showed 1.33 eggs. We should reconcile and re-provision from source. For reference while reviewing, I captured the live values currently running on staging, pasted below.

settings of bawif-fawif:
ralix:
  log_level: warn
  metrics_host: metrics.ralix.tolvaqsys.internal
  pool_size: 32

## Runbook: `stringsift` extraction stalls

If the stringsift script hangs during translation-string extraction, it's almost always a malformed template in the Ashgrove repo. Kill the run, check the last file it touched, and file a ticket against localization. Don't retry more than twice. The full troubleshooting checklist lives here:

runbook for badug-kadup: https://confluence.zemvarlabs.internal/projects/browse/display/projects/bd1b

- [ ] Step 7: Archive cold storage buckets (Glacierline tier). Confirm both ceremony witnesses are present, verify bucket manifests match the Oxbow ledger, then seal the archive key shares. Plugin authors may observe but not handle shares. Once sealed, the archive index itself is encrypted and can only be reopened with the passphrase below.

vault phrase of badup-hahig = tamael-aldael-kelmir-istael-fenok-istwyn-tamius-jorath-oliion